Triangle XYZ is translated down 4 units and to the left 8 units. The length of side XY is 10 units. What is the length of side X'Y'?

Since triangle XYZ is translated down 4 units and to the left 8 units, each corresponding point on the new triangle X'Y'Z' will be 4 units below and 8 units to the left of the corresponding point on triangle XYZ.

Therefore, since side XY is 10 units, the length of side X'Y' will also be 10 units.
